Designed with a Y-shaped hull and fueled by LNG MSC World Europa is billed as the cruise companys most innovative and environmentally advanced vessel to date. MSC Cruises World Class cruise ships will feature 2760 staterooms and a maximum occupancy of 6850 guests the highest passenger capacity in the global cruise fleet. MSC World Class will have a larger guest capacity of maximum 6850 pax compared to 6780 guest capacity of Harmony of the Seas.

Other details about the MSC World Class ships include length of 330 metres width of 47 metres a Y-shape hull design that is supposed to allow for better views and more balcony cabins. Powered by LNG one of the the worlds cleanest marine fuels and featuring breakthrough green technologies MSC World Europa symbolizes the beginning of a new era of cruising.
